 awestruck ['ɔstrʌk]   添加此单词到默认生词本
a. 敬畏的, 畏惧的

  1. The problem is that most people are awestruck by your fabulousness.
    问题是大多数人对你只是肃然起敬。
  2. Though many people are awestruck by her title, Queen Rania remains humble.
    尽管很多人对她的皇后身份感到有点畏惧,但雷妮亚皇后仍保持谦逊的态度。
  3. But when the crowds saw this, they were awestruck, and glorified God, who had given such authority to men.
    太9:8众人看见都惊奇、归荣耀与神.为他将这样的权柄赐给人。


awestruck
[ adj ]
having or showing a feeling of mixed reverence and respect and wonder and dread
<adj.all>
stood in awed silence before the shrinein grim despair and awestruck wonder


  1. Michael Dukakis toured Yellowstone National Park and said he was "awestruck" by the summer's fire damage.
  2. Among the things that leave them awestruck are intellectual gymnastics, a compelling ability to communicate, physical attractiveness and personal charm.
